Como executar um comando shell a partir de um “starter”?

1

Eu gostaria de executar um comando clicando duas vezes em um starter na minha área de trabalho do Ubuntu Lucid. Mais especificamente, gostaria de iniciar uma sessão rdesktop . Eu entrei assim

rdesktop -u user -d domain address.to.remote.server

no campo Comando do iniciador. No entanto, o clique duplo não faz nada, mesmo que o inicial esteja definido como executável . O que estou fazendo errado?

    
por sgbmyr 07.04.2011 / 13:36

1 resposta

2

Graças à dica de verificar o .xsession-errors log, consegui resolver minha própria pergunta. De fato, percebi que o sinal %

rdesktop -u user -d domain -g 90% address.to.remote.server

deve ter um escape de %% , como em -g 90%% . Estranhamente, isso não é necessário se o comando for inserido diretamente no shell.

    
por 07.04.2011 / 17:04